Description
Step into a world of sonic exploration with the Peavey Raptor Plus EXP, a dynamic electric guitar that blends classic aesthetics with modern innovation. This solid body electric guitar is tailored for musicians seeking versatility and style without breaking the bank. Its innovative Powerbend tremolo bridge allows for smooth pitch variations, inviting you to experiment with soundscapes that range from subtly expressive to wildly evocative.
The Raptor Plus EXP features three single-coil pickups, each engineered with wide top pole pieces, presenting a broader string window to capture an expansive range of tones. Whether you're strumming chords or picking intricate solos, this guitar's ability to deliver clear, focused sound ensures that every note resonates with precision. The new dual expanding truss rod offers a wrenchless, easy-access adjustment wheel, giving you the freedom to customize your neck relief effortlessly, keeping your action and tuning stability on point.
Anchored by a 25-1/2" scale length, the Raptor Plus EXP is designed for comfort and playability. The 6-in-a-line headstock not only presents ergonomic tuner placement but also ensures straight string pull, minimizing friction and maintaining tuning integrity. With master volume and tone controls, as well as a 5-way pickup selector offering hum canceling in the 2nd and 4th positions, this guitar is your ticket to a versatile and reliable performance on stage or in the studio.

Mods and upgrades
-
Upgrading to vintage-style pickups with Alnico II magnets is recommended for those looking to achieve a warmer, more classic tone.
Source -
Owners suggest replacing the stock bridge with a Made in Mexico Fender bridge for improved performance, noting it fits well without major modifications.
Source -
Strat pickguards can be used but require filing on the horn for proper fit, resulting in slight off-centered alignment.
Source -
Applying aluminum tape on the pickguard's back can act as a budget "anti-static" shield, though it may need fitment adjustments.
